Jesus, due to His miraculous works in the town of Capernaum, became immensely popular overnight. Yet, to the surprise and dismay of His disciples, Jesus expressed His desire to visit other towns as well, to proclaim the message of the kingdom of God. His mission was never about winning a popularity contest but about sharing the good news of eternal salvation. He was not swayed by the demands of the masses but remained aligned with the divine timetable.
Who sets the priorities in your life—God or your own desires? Are you driven by the pursuit of popularity and success, or by a longing to fulfill God’s purpose for your life? It is only through unwavering dedication to God, nurtured by undistracted prayer and meditation on His Word, that we can discern what truly matters. Guided by the Spirit, with our eyes fixed on Jesus, we can then walk in a way that glorifies our Heavenly Father.
